When: Sundays 11am – 12 midday
Where: Car Park Rooftop, Federation Square, Melbourne
Cost: FREE
Have you been to the Pop Up Patch behind Fed Square on the roof of the car park? What was once a drab car park has been transformed into a beautiful veggie garden (you can rent a box and join in the veggie growing fun if you get really carried away).
On Sundays the guys are running scarecrow making workshops – turn up with your old clothes and transform them into scarecrows to take home for your veggie garden.
We attended another of their scarecrow making events earlier this year – it was just a one-off at that time but the kids loved it… I haven’t told them about the new weekly classes tho – I suspect we might get some odd looks on the way home on the tram with a couple of scarecrows!
